Crocus sativus saffron crocus corms are available from january. Harvest flowering time is autumn. Crocus chrysanthus advance. Grow your own saffron threads which you will see in the supermarkets for more than 130 per gram or just enjoy the fragrant purple flowers either in pots or mass planted.
Crocus saffron crocus sativus produces lilac flowers with dark purple veins on the petals in autumn the orange red saffron stigmas are highly prized and used in cooking and as a dye. Each flower will only produce 3 stigmas and each saffron crocus bulb will only produce 1 flower. Suited to temperate gardens it relishes dry summers and cool winters.
